A leading collectibles company in Greater London is looking for a Buyer to shape the product assortment and drive success on digital platforms. The ideal candidate will have a strong e-commerce background, particularly in the collectible or toy industry, and a passion for pop culture.
You will lead product development, manage inventory, and develop marketing strategies to enhance customer experience. Strong analytical skills and teamwork are essential to excel in this role.
